Abstract
The utility model discloses an efficient copper strips cleaning and drying device, the on -line screen storage device comprises a base, the front surface of base is equipped with the controller, turn right from a left side and be equipped with water tank, washing case and stoving case in proper order in the top of base, the inside of water tank is equipped with first water pump, the top of first water pump leads to one side intercommunication of pipe and washing case, the inner wall top fixed mounting who washs the case has the standpipe, and the one end of standpipe with extend to the cross current that washs the incasement, the shower nozzle is installed to the bottom of standpipe, the inner chamber bottom of wasing the case is equipped with the pond, and is equipped with the second water pump in the pond, the bottom of second water pump is equipped with the wet return. This efficient copper strips cleaning and drying device washs conveniently and has reached the even effect of the washing of copper strips to timely drying after the washing has improved the quality of copper strips, guarantees the effect of its use.

Background technology
Copper strips is a kind of hardware, mainly for the production of electric elements, lamp holder, battery cap, button,
Sealing member and connector, be mainly used as conduction, heat conduction and anti-corrosion equipment, as electric components, switch,
Packing ring, pad, electron tube, radiator, conduction mother metal and radiator, fin and cylinder sheet
Etc. various parts.The copper strips rolling to be carried out cleaned and blowing again, through repeatedly drawing, tension force control
System differs, and physical property can be deteriorated, but the existing cleaning to copper strips is more complicated, and cleaning performance is bad,
And can not dry timely after cleaning, cause the Quality Down of copper strips, affect its using effect.
